#1d3a16 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d3a16 is composed of 11.4% red, 22.7%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.1% yellow and 77.3% black. It has a hue angle of 108.3 degrees, a saturation of 45% and a lightness of 15.7%. #1d3a16 color hex could be obtained by blending #3a742c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#1d3a16 color description : Very dark lime green.
#1d3a16 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d3a16 has RGB values of R:29, G:58,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.77. Its decimal value is 1915414.
